Cota Heu
Cota Heu is a locality in Ponilala, Ermera and has an elevation of 1,124 metres. Cota Heu is situated nearby to the hamlet Kotaheo, as well as near Eroho.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Gleno and Buku Mera.
Gleno

Gleno is a city in Timor-Leste, 30 kilometres to the southwest of Dili, the national capital. It is in the suco of Riheu. Gleno has a population of 8,133.
Buku Mera
Hamlet
Buku Mera is a village situated midways up a mountain range, in the East Timor Liquiçá District. The village is located to the south east of the Liquiçá township, halfway between Liquiçá and Bazartete. Buku Mera is situated 10 km north of Cota Heu.
